Senior Industrialization / Manufacturing Engineering Manager Battery Cell Manufacturing (Greenfield Project)
Location: Nouvelle-Aquitaine, France (Bordeaux, Angoulme, or Poitiers area)
Reporting to: Plant General Manager & Group Industrial Project Director
Overview:
We are seeking a passionate and experienced Senior Industrialization Manager to lead the plant manufacturing engineering , industrialisation , including a major strategic greenfield industrial projectthe development and launch of a new battery cell manufacturing facility dedicated to high-tech industries including aerospace, defense, marine, rail, and mobility (excluding automotive). This is a key role within a group engaged in the energy transition and future-facing technologies.
This position combines industrial project execution and new product launch management, while also building and leading a team of technical specialists and working closely with international teams in North America.
Your Mission: Orchestrate the Entire Industrial Project Lifecycle
Reporting directly to the Plant General Manager and the Division Industrial Project Director, you will be responsible for managing the end-to-end industrialization of a state-of-the-art manufacturing site with a targeted capacity of 300,000 battery cells annually.
Key Responsibilities:
1. Project Feasibility & Planning
- Lead feasibility studies for a multi-million-euro investment.
- Define technical infrastructure and production equipment requirements in coordination with engineering teams.
2. Equipment Sourcing & Procurement
- Identify and select vendors for complex machinery (chemical and mechanical processes: mixing, coating, electrode manufacturing, assembly, testing).
- Oversee equipment design, build, and acceptance.
3. Project Execution & Ramp-Up
- Supervise on-site installation, commissioning, and pilot line start-up.
- Drive ramp-up and performance stabilization of production equipment.
4. Governance & Reporting
- Report directly to the Plant GM with responsibility for budget, timeline, and quality control throughout the project lifecycle.
5. Launch Management
- Support and manage future industrial product launches within the plant.
- Coordinate with international R&D and industrial teams to ensure successful production readiness.
